
San Diego, CA (June 18, 2019) On the morning of June 18th, a hit-and-run pedestrian accident happened on the Ocean Beach Pier. An Acura was traveling at 50 miles per hour when it struck two pedestrians who were fishing. The driver then struck a police cruiser right after making a U-turn and speeding away. The […]